Stumbled across this gem while browsing for something different, and boy, did it deliver. Melon Sandbox throws you into a physics playground where literally anything goes. Want to see what happens when you drop a barrel on a character? Go for it. Feel like organizing a demolition derby with armored vehicles? The game's got your back. Released on 01.01.2023 and regularly updated (latest on 08.06.2025), this sandbox keeps evolving with fresh content and community mods.
What hooked me wasn't the graphics or some epic storyline - it's the pure freedom to experiment. You're basically a mad scientist with unlimited resources and zero consequences. The physics engine handles everything from gentle nudges to explosive collisions, and watching the ragdoll characters react never gets old.
The beauty lies in its simplicity - just pick your tools and start experimenting. You've got melee weapons, guns, barrels, magical syringes, and armored vehicles at your disposal. Drop items, watch reactions, save your wildest creations, and share them with other players. The real fun starts when you download community mods that completely transform your playground.
Start small with basic interactions before diving into complex scenarios. Save your favorite setups - you'll want to recreate that perfect chain reaction later. Don't forget to explore the mod community; some players create absolutely insane contraptions that'll blow your mind.
